Beulah is an Australian property developer based in Melbourne with international operations that have moved quickly from boutique developments to significant projects, in particular, a series of high profile developments in planning stages.

One of Beulah's most notable projects is a collaboration with Openwork Landscape Architects to create a series of ecological gardens. The Provenance Camberwell is a boutique collection of ten house-sized residences, situated in Camberwell. The development is segmented into three residential buildings, with Botanic apartments on level one.

Another of their high-profile projects in the pipeline is Southbank by Beulah situated at the current BMW Showroom, which will be transformed into a multi-use development. It introduces the 'vertical village' concept, which supports The City of Melbourne's 'Future Melbourne 2026' plan. The development will feature two twisting terraced forms called the 'Green Spine' concept, which won awards in the global architecture competition.
